Our Cloud-Native Application Development Services

Cloud-Native Architecture Design

Design scalable architectures using microservices, containers, and managed cloud services.

Microservices Development

Build loosely coupled services for flexibility, scalability, and faster releases.

Serverless Application Development

Develop event-driven applications using AWS Lambda, Azure Functions, and GCP Cloud Functions.

Containerization & Orchestration

Containerize applications with Docker and orchestrate using Kubernetes.

API-First Development

Build scalable, secure APIs for internal and external integrations.

Cloud-Native Databases & Storage

Use managed databases and storage optimized for performance and scalability.

DevOps & CI/CD Pipelines

Automate build, test, deployment, and rollback workflows.

Cloud Security & Observability

Implement IAM, monitoring, logging, and alerting from day one.

Pricing — Cloud-Native Application Development

Pricing depends on architecture complexity and scale.

Cloud-Native MVP

$15,000–$30,000

Production Cloud-Native App

$30,000–$80,000

Enterprise Cloud-Native Platform

$80,000–$200,000+
